1999 Citroen XM V6 Automatic Exclusive WITH FULLY SEQUENTIAL LPG KIT Mauritius Blue in colourUnmarked black leather

interior171k milesNo tax or MOT4 good tyres6 CD ChangerTowbar with electrics Great condition for age and mileage. Unfortunately the 4HP20 Automatic gearbox on this car has stopped working.There is a whining noise coming from the car. I bought it in March with the intentions of removing the gearbox andrefurbishing it unfortunately though due to time constraints I've not hadtime to get anywhere near it. Car is in great condition, all of the cills are sound. Car is located 17 miles west of Glasgow. Collection is preferred however Imay be able to deliver it depending upon buyers location. Any questions, give me a shout! Not really sure what the car is worth to be honest so going to ask foroffers over £250. David.
